package org.apache.jmeter.listeners;
import org.apache.jmeter.junit.JMeterTestCase;
import org.apache.jmeter.reporters.ResultAction;
import org.apache.jmeter.samplers.SampleEvent;
import org.apache.jmeter.samplers.SampleResult;
import org.apache.jmeter.threads.JMeterContext;
import org.apache.jmeter.threads.JMeterContextService;
import org.apache.jmeter.threads.JMeterVariables;
import org.junit.Assert;
import org.junit.Before;
import org.junit.Test;
/**
* Test for {@link ResultAction}
*/
public class TestResultAction extends JMeterTestCase {
private ResultAction resultAction;
private SampleResult sampleResult;
private final String data = "response Data";
@Before
public void setUp() {
JMeterContext jmctx = JMeterContextService.getContext();
resultAction = new ResultAction();
resultAction.setThreadContext(jmctx);
JMeterVariables vars = new JMeterVariables();
jmctx.setVariables(vars);
sampleResult = new SampleResult();
sampleResult.setResponseData(data, null);
}
@Test
public void testSuccess() {
sampleResult.setSuccessful(true);
resultAction.setErrorAction(ResultAction.ON_ERROR_STOPTEST);
resultAction.sampleOccurred(new SampleEvent(sampleResult, "JUnit-TG"));
Assert.assertFalse(sampleResult.isStopTest());
}
@Test
public void testOnFailureStopTest() {
sampleResult.setSuccessful(false);
resultAction.setErrorAction(ResultAction.ON_ERROR_STOPTEST);
resultAction.sampleOccurred(new SampleEvent(sampleResult, "JUnit-TG"));
Assert.assertTrue(sampleResult.isStopTest());
Assert.assertFalse(sampleResult.isStopTestNow());
Assert.assertFalse(sampleResult.isStopThread());
Assert.assertFalse(sampleResult.isStartNextThreadLoop());
}
@Test
public void testOnFailureStopTestNow() {
sampleResult.setSuccessful(false);
resultAction.setErrorAction(ResultAction.ON_ERROR_STOPTEST_NOW);
resultAction.sampleOccurred(new SampleEvent(sampleResult, "JUnit-TG"));
Assert.assertFalse(sampleResult.isStopTest());
Assert.assertTrue(sampleResult.isStopTestNow());
Assert.assertFalse(sampleResult.isStopThread());
Assert.assertFalse(sampleResult.isStartNextThreadLoop());
}
@Test
public void testOnFailureStopThread() {
sampleResult.setSuccessful(false);
resultAction.setErrorAction(ResultAction.ON_ERROR_STOPTHREAD);
resultAction.sampleOccurred(new SampleEvent(sampleResult, "JUnit-TG"));
Assert.assertFalse(sampleResult.isStopTest());
Assert.assertFalse(sampleResult.isStopTestNow());
Assert.assertTrue(sampleResult.isStopThread());
Assert.assertFalse(sampleResult.isStartNextThreadLoop());
}
@Test
public void testOnFailureStartNextThreadLoop() {
sampleResult.setSuccessful(false);
resultAction.setErrorAction(ResultAction.ON_ERROR_START_NEXT_THREAD_LOOP);
resultAction.sampleOccurred(new SampleEvent(sampleResult, "JUnit-TG"));
Assert.assertFalse(sampleResult.isStopTest());
Assert.assertFalse(sampleResult.isStopTestNow());
Assert.assertFalse(sampleResult.isStopThread());
Assert.assertTrue(sampleResult.isStartNextThreadLoop());
}
}
